Finished anime Deca-Dence today. It was quite a ride.
Generally, I do not like when shows break their own rules. Usually it does not rally work, looks sloppy and used simply because creators do not see where to move the story and simply do not wish to finish it just yet. Or they never really had a strict set of rules, which implies little thought into the setting or lore.
Deca-Dence is a rare exception: it starts breaking rules from the first episode even, but here it makes sense, because of "meta" theme(s): what we see is just "lowest" layer of existence described in the show, and there is a higher one, which works differently and we do not know anything about it and how it was created. Some revelations in the story could remind you of Shingeki no Kyojin.
And it's not only that, that can remind you of Titans: it's also the fighting that takes place in mid-air. It's more futuristic and bends physics quite a bit more, but it still looks quite good an dynamic. And while the story itself is not so much about fighting per say (although about perseverance in general), fighting scenes fit the flow (which sometimes failed in Titans).
The show is definitely unique in its presentation, though. Yes, it can also remind you of Tengen Toppa Gurren Lagann in some scenes, but as with Titans it looks more like the show took inspiration from it.
Some may find it a bit simple and predictable after a certain set of "rules" are broken, but I do not think you will have enough time to bother with it. At least, I did not have time to nitpick while watching it.
